Book Synopsis
An introductory guide to 180 species of bird commonly found throughout Scotland in the best-selling pocketable Gem format.Unlike many field guides, Gem Scottish Birds does not cover birds which only visit occasionally, or which occur in such small numbers and are so difficult to identify that only experienced birdwatchers can spot them. Instead, it concentrates on the commoner species that the amateur birdwatcher is most likely to see, plus a few scarcer ones of particular interest.The entries are grouped taxonomically, with a detailed introduction to all the different habitats.
